Ordinals
beta
Address 14mnW1V57pzebQzsTXwz4P4hFLGF4E1SsE
sat balance
524
runes balances
outputs
275cf127389384440eeeb630eae8a84e18bca36ff8f1b98eccf687e6418ede12:1